Obtained Flip Ultra, disassembled, removed LCD, installed in Mino. Presto, Chango,
Details: The LCD in the Ultra is the exact same component used in the Mino. There are about a million screws in the Ultra. The bad news is that as I was happily snapping away pix with the digital camera, I did not notice that my SD card was not in the camera. So no Ultra disassembly photos. All components in the Ultra are held in by screws from the front and back, so the circuit board must be removed to gain access to these screws. The front plastic pieces on the Ultra are held in by 8 screws (two are smaller than the rest). Once these are removed the back cover comes off with some convincing.
After experiencing difficulty in getting the Ultra back together after completely removing the board, I decided to forgo further disassembly on the Mino. (This also would have necessitated removing the ribbon connector from the back cover again. )
